D.I. in San Jose

Formed in the early ’80s in a studio behind a Fullerton pawnshop, DI embodies the energetic angst of classic SoCal punk rock. The band features vocalist Casey Royer, formerly of the Adolescents and Social Distortion. DI’s oeuvre is foundational for any hardcore punk fan, especially their cult-favorite second album, 1986’s Horse Bites Dog Cries. With four decades on the scene and counting, Royer continues to slice through the noise of everyday life with sharp social awareness and humor. What’s more, he’s optimistic about the future. In May 2023, he told Blast TV, “Punk rock is coming back in a big way.” (AM)
